GetSportsFocus.com – Justin Lum highlighted 10 football players from the Bay Area who signed letters of intent to major D-1 colleges. Among those are top recruits Joe Mixon from Freedom High who signed on to play for Oklahoma, Palo Alto’s Keller Chryst to Stanford and WCAL Co-MVP Chandler Ramirez who decided to go play for the Army.
